I smoke 5-6 cigars every day and enjoy every single one of them. I start in the morning with something mild to medium( Diamond Crown #6 or #2 , Ashton Cabinet #7, Davidoff Aniversary Tubo #3, Don Carlos #3), then move up the strength scale from there. My usual second smoke of the day is a Padron Aniversario Maduro in differing sizes or a medium strength Cuban like a Juan Lopez #1, Upmann Super Corona, Hoyo Epi #1. I then move up the strength scale with Cubans the rest of the day. Probably 2-3 times a week I will smoke an Opus X as my last cigar of the day.

Depends on my mood. Some weekends, when I have nothing pressing, I like to get up around 7am and light up my first cigar with my morning coffee. I usually have my second around 10 am. I can still enjoy a cigar in the afternoon and another in the evening. So, I guess my "enjoyment" maxes out at 4.

It also depends on the strength and size of the sticks. I can't do 4 double coronas and I can't do 4 really strong cigars. I can mix them up with sizes and strength and enjoy them all.
